Prod ingestion nodes for the Splintr crash pipeline have drifted from the release baseline. Three hosts still carry the old symbolication batch size and the pre-freeze retention window; two others disabled dedupe sampling entirely during last month's incident and never reverted. Result: inconsistent crash counts between dashboards, blocking the go/no-go call. Need a full re-apply from the baseline before Thursday's release train. No code change required, config only. The baseline values we must converge on are below.

settings of fafog-haduf:
ZORIX_PIN=4648
ZORIX_METRICS_HOST=metrics.zorix.paliqsys.corp
ZORIX_LOG_LEVEL=info
ZORIX_TENANT=druix

Quellbot collapses duplicate on-call alerts before they reach the pager. It reads all configuration from /opt/quellbot/.env at startup; changes require a restart. QUELLBOT_WINDOW_SECONDS controls the dedup window (default 120). QUELLBOT_FINGERPRINT_FIELDS lists the alert fields used for matching; trimming this list too aggressively can merge unrelated incidents, so coordinate with the Harbin team first. Quellbot also needs an API credential to acknowledge suppressed alerts upstream, and that credential is set on the line directly below.

env line for tawig-kadup: VAULT_KEY5=07c4f

Welcome to the Frostvault plugin program. Plugins that archive cold storage buckets must request the archival scope before calling the Frostvault lifecycle API. Archival runs are batched nightly, so test against the staging tier first. Once your plugin is registered, add the archival credential to your local env file on the line below.

vault entry, yahif-yajep: COURIER_KEY29=b802bdf8034096b65a51c6ba5abe2

## Build Provenance: Kioskline Watchdog

Every watchdog binary shipped to Kioskline terminals is built on the Verlo pipeline, which records the compiler version, dependency lockfile hash, and signing step in an attestation bundle. Before deploying to any kiosk, verify the bundle against the manifest in the release folder. The attestation for the current watchdog build is pinned below.

session token of yajof-bagef = htk4_937d